Garapan Boat Channel
Garapan Boat Channel is a channel in Saipan, Northern Mariana Islands. Garapan Boat Channel is situated nearby to the locality Gualo Rai Village, as well as near the destroyed locality Garapan - JP Marianas Capital Village pre-WW2.| Tap on a place to explore it |

The NMI Museum of History and Culture, also known as the NMI Museum, is a museum in Garapan, Saipan hosting exhibitions about the Chamorro and Carolinian people and also displays artifacts, documents, textiles, and photographs from the Spanish, German, Japanese, and American periods in the Northern Mariana Islands.

Sugar King Park is a municipal park located in Garapan, Saipan, Northern Mariana Islands across from the NMI Museum of History and Culture. The park was named in honor of the "Sugar King" Haruji Matsue, director of the South Seas Development Company.

The Japanese Hospital or Saipan Byoin is a historic World War II-era hospital complex on Route 3 in Garapan, a village on the island of Saipan in the Northern Mariana Islands.

Capitol Hill is a settlement on the island of Saipan in the Northern Mariana Islands. It has a population of around 1,000. Capitol Hill has been the territory's seat of government since 1962. Capitol Hill is situated 3 miles east of Garapan Boat Channel.

Tanapag is a settlement on the island of Saipan in the Northern Mariana Islands. It is located close to Tanapag Beach on the northwest coast, just to the north of Capital Hill, the island group's center of government. Tanapag is situated 4½ miles northeast of Garapan Boat Channel.
